What are the responsibilities and job description for the Retail Manager position at Centerra Co-Op?
Job Title: Retail Manager Location: Ravenna Position Objective:The retail manager will direct and promote Centerra Country Store in a manner that optimizes the cooperative's market share. They are responsible for improving overall efficiency and coordinating store activities within the community and collectively within Centerra.

Position Responsibilities:A successful retail manager will proactively supervise staff while building profitability and sales. In addition, they will maintain the facility, grounds and all equipment and perform other duties as assigned by management. The manager will have a positive attitude, foster an environment of teamwork within the store and promote a favorable image of the cooperative both internally and externally.
- Lead, hire and manage team members and actively support their growth and promotion
- Improve and maintain personal and team training and product knowledge
- Recognize strengths in others and nurture those to develop long-term employees
- Increase profitability through promotions, merchandising and efficiency
- Inventory control including complete and accurate physical counts annually
- Product margin analysis and reporting
- Effective merchandising including rotation of stock, end-caps and store displays
- Coordinate with cooperative marketing personnel to carry out sales, promotions and events
- Maintain interior and exterior of facility including building, grounds and all equipment
